TOLL OF NEW ZEALANDERS.
ADDITIONS TO THE LIST.
(Press Association.) WELLINGTON, May 12. The High Commissioner reports as follows, under date London, May li, C.50 p.m.: — MISSING. .New Zealand Staff Corps: Captain A. S. Morton. KILLED IN ACTION. Canterbury Battalion: Second Lieut. W. C. Skelton. Otngo Battalion: Lieut. J. S. Reid. WOUNDED AND MISSING. OtiißO Eattaliou: Lieut. H. L. Richards. WOUNDED. Otngo Battalion: Cnpt. W. Fleming. Major George Mitchell. Lieut. D. J. A. Klyttle. Lieut. R. E. Egglestone. New Zealand Engineers: Captain P. Waite (slightly wounded). Captain D. Simpson.
Captain A. B. .Morton, who is reported missing, served in the South African war In 1901-2. He was in command of No. 1 Group of the Auckland Military district.
